What We Are Reading In November

 

In November we are going to look into the topic of giving thanks . We are going to take a look at several passages that will remind us of the importance of thankfulness BUT also passages that will point us to things we should be thankful for and I pray that it will help you (and myself) to remember all that we have to be thankful for, especially the things God has done for us. 

One thing we must be aware of when doing topical studies is making sure we keep everything in context so I have done my best to make sure we are looking at the whole context when digging into these verses. I would encourage you to journal as you read this month. Write down those verses that stick out to you and how it reminds you to be thankful. 

Why Do You Include Catch Up Days?

I know life happens and we can get behind so  I have even built in a catch up day every 7 days. If you are on track and don’t need the catch up day I would encourage you to read a psalms or read over the passage from your Sunday service.
